Message type: E = Error
Message class: RESRTM - Error Texts for Sales-Based Rent Terms
Message number: 060
Message text: &1: meter &2 does not belong to rental object &3

- &1: meter &2 does not belong to rental object &3 ?The SAP error message RESRTM060 indicates that there is a mismatch between a meter and the rental object it is associated with. Specifically, the error message states that the meter (identified by &2) does not belong to the specified rental object (identified by &3). This can occur in scenarios involving rental contracts, equipment management, or utility billing where meters are linked to specific rental objects.
Causes:
- Incorrect Meter Assignment: The meter may not be correctly assigned to the rental object in the system. This can happen if the meter was moved or if there was an error during data entry.
- Data Migration Issues: If data was migrated from another system or if there were changes in the configuration, the meter might not have been properly linked to the rental object.
- Configuration Errors: There may be issues in the configuration settings that define the relationship between meters and rental objects.
- Inactive or Deleted Meters: The meter may have been marked as inactive or deleted in the system, leading to this error when trying to access it.
Solutions:
- Check Meter Assignment: Verify that the meter is correctly assigned to the rental object. You can do this by checking the master data for both the meter and the rental object in the SAP system.
- Reassign the Meter: If the meter is not assigned correctly, you may need to reassign it to the correct rental object. This can typically be done through the relevant transaction codes in SAP (e.g., using transaction code IE02 for equipment).
-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ings related to rental objects and meters to ensure they are set up correctly. This may involve consulting with your SAP Basis or configuration team.
- Data Consistency Check: Run data consistency checks to identify any discrepancies in the master data that may be causing the issue.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ance on handling this error message.
